XAU Resources Provides Corporate Update on Quartzstone Transaction, Fortuna Exploration Program and Noseno Project

XAU’s QS Holdings RTO is halted by TSXV review while Fortuna leads a $5.6m drilling program in Guyana.

Executive Summary

XAU Resources Inc. (GIG) issued a corporate update on August 14, 2026, regarding the ongoing review by the TSX Venture Exchange (TSXV) of its proposed reverse takeover (RTO) of QS Holdings Inc. (QSH). The review has resulted in a continued trading halt for the company’s shares.

The release outlined a US$5.6 million exploration program for 2026 at the Quartzstone Gold Project, led by partner Fortuna Mining Corp. The program focuses on 5,000 meters of diamond drilling, geophysics, and geochemistry. Concurrently, QSH announced a non-brokered private placement for gross proceeds of C$10M–C$20M at C$0.50 per subscription receipt, conditional on TSXV acceptance.

An updated NI 43-101 technical report for the Noseno Project recommends a staged US$2.4 million exploration program that includes trenching and contingent drilling. Historical progression of the transaction shows an initial letter of intent in April 2026, a definitive agreement in June 2026, and an NI 43-101 filing in July 2026. The transaction remains subject to shareholder approval, TSXV acceptance, and the concurrent financing.

Material Impact

XAU Resources Inc. (GIG) issued a routine status update confirming it is actively responding to TSXV comments and advancing exploration budgets as previously outlined. The company did not introduce genuinely new, unexpected, or market-moving information. Trading remains halted, maintaining zero liquidity and freezing price discovery.

The Fortuna exploration budget and Noseno program are incremental follow-ups to the July technical report and align with prior expectations. Concurrent financing terms of C$0.50 per share match the definitive agreement valuation, indicating no renegotiation but also no discount to attract capital quickly.

From a risk perspective, the continued halt and reliance on a C$10M–C$20M raise to close the deal maintain significant execution and dilution risk. The market has already priced in the RTO at $0.50, and this update merely sustains the status quo.

Company Overview

XAU Resources Inc. (GIG) is a pre-revenue junior explorer focused on early-stage gold projects in Guyana. Its flagship asset is the Quartzstone Gold Project, acquired via QS Holdings, which comprises 83 contiguous medium-scale mining permits covering approximately 296 km² in the Cuyuni-Mazaruni region. The project is situated in a geological context featuring shear-hosted quartz-tourmaline veining near Zijin’s Aurora mine and G Mining’s Oko project.

Historical data indicates approximately 355,100 oz of unverified historical production. A historical resource estimate of approximately 458,000 oz (Indicated + Inferred) was based on 2020 Wardell Armstrong data, though management notes this estimate is outdated and requires verification. The company also holds the Noseno Project, which features favorable orogenic gold geology and a recommended US$2.4M staged exploration program.
